Latest Patents
Zhabokrug's latest patents include a "Safety Cap for Tire Valve" and a "Safety Core for Tire Valve." The safety cap is designed to automatically adjust tire pressure by releasing excess air when it exceeds a predetermined maximum allowable value. This is achieved through a control valve mechanism that ensures optimal tire performance under varying conditions. The safety core, on the other hand, features a ball-type check valve that opens to release air when tire pressure surpasses the set limit, thereby preventing potential tire damage.
